Late blues from Howlin' Wolf here, and a cracker it is. To anyone familiar with Led Zeppelin, you will immediately recognise the link between this and their "Lemon Song" which was subtitled "Killing Floor" and incorporated part of the music from the Howlin' Wolf track, one of the reasons why Messrs. Page and Plant were frequently accused of plagiarism. The Howlin' Wolf version has a freshness and originality all its own and still stands up today. And the Wolf's distinctive voice lends it a character all its own. Like a lot of electric blues this was later to be sadly overshadowed by the rise of acts such as Cream and Led Zeppelin.
